Right then, gather round for this Serie B showdown. Juventude host CRB at the home turf, and if you’re looking for a end-to-end thriller, you might want to check the scorecard first. This is Brazilian football, and these two sides are set up more like a tactical chess match than a goal-fest.
Juventude have been absolute masters of the graft at home. In their last ten games, they’ve kept a clean sheet in eight of them, conceding a mere 0.20 goals per match on their own patch. They’re sitting second in the table with 42 points, and their recent results speak volumes: 1-0 wins over Goias and Novorizontino, plus a couple of 0-0 stalemates against tough opposition like Fortaleza. They don’t need to score a hundred to win; they just need to shut the door and nick a goal on the break.
CRB, meanwhile, are flying high in seventh place with 36 points and a blistering 60% win rate over their last ten outings. Away from home, they’ve won four of their last five, chipping in 1.00 goal per game. But here’s the rub: facing a side that concedes barely a goal every five games is a different kettle of fish. CRB’s attack has been decent, but Juve’s backline has been practically unbreachable lately.
The head-to-head record doesn’t exactly scream ‘goal machine’ either. Juve have won four in a row at home against CRB, with their last meeting ending 1-0. The maths back this up too, with expected goals sitting at a lowly 1.50 for the whole fixture. When you combine Juve’s defensive wall, CRB’s solid but not explosive away form, and a history of tight scores, the board is practically begging for a low-scoring affair.
